Q: Is 2,088,388 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,088,388 is a composite number.

Why is 2,088,388 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,088,388 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 127 254 508 4,111 8,222 16,444 522,097 1,044,194 and 2,088,388, with no remainder.

Since 2,088,388 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,088,388, it is a composite number.
